Commencing with one of the most usually questioned concerns — is rolling motion there for neet 2025? Rolling motion is a concept frequently included under Physics in Class 11, specially during the chapter on ‘Method of Particles and Rotational Motion’. In modern NEET examinations, when rotational movement to be a broader topic was A part of the syllabus, the specific topic of rolling motion continues to be inconsistently emphasized. As per The newest NMC-issued NEET 2025 syllabus, rolling movement is not really included. This is in keeping with the latest rationalization of topics to lessen the load on college students and streamline the syllabus across boards. Thus, learners can confidently exclude rolling motion from their in depth NEET 2025 preparation plan.

Future, Permit’s go over the vernier caliper — a extensively-used measuring instrument analyzed beneath the chapter ‘Models and Measurements’ at school 11 Physics. In past several years, the vernier caliper and screw gauge had been Element of the NEET Physics syllabus, and occasionally thoughts appeared on them. On the other hand, according to the NEET 2025 syllabus produced through the NMC, vernier caliper continues to be excluded. The main target has now shifted much more toward core conceptual knowledge as opposed to the mechanical utilization of devices. Consequently, learners can skip comprehensive review of the vernier caliper and screw gauge for NEET 2025, Unless of course They are really preparing for additional entrance examinations that also address these instruments.

Coming back for the core framework of your NEET 2025 syllabus, a critical issue stays — what number of chapters are A part of full? The NEET syllabus comprises a few main topics: Physics, Chemistry, and Biology, Every spanning Class eleven and Course twelve curricula. For Biology, which carries the most weightage with ninety questions in the NEET exam, there are a complete of ten chapters from Course 11 and 10 chapters from Course twelve, bringing the entire to 20 chapters. These chapters include essential matters like ‘Variety of Living Organisms’, ‘Structural Organisation in Animals and Crops’, ‘Mobile Construction and Function’, ‘Genetics and Evolution’, ‘Ecology’, and ‘Human Physiology’.

In Physics, the syllabus is split involving 10 chapters in Class eleven and 9 chapters in school 12, totaling 19 chapters. These contain important chapters such as ‘Guidelines of Motion’, ‘Work, Electrical power and Electric power’, ‘Thermodynamics’, ‘Electrostatics’, ‘Existing Electricity’, and ‘Magnetic Outcomes of Present and Magnetism’. As outlined previously, subject areas for example rolling movement and vernier caliper are not Element of the Physics syllabus for NEET 2025.

Chemistry contributes 30 chapters in overall — 14 from Class eleven and sixteen from Class 12. This will make Chemistry the subject with by far the most quantity of chapters Among the many a few. Nonetheless, not all chapters have equivalent weight. Core ideas from chapters which include ‘Organic Chemistry - Some Standard Rules and Techniques’, ‘Thermodynamics’, ‘Chemical Bonding and Molecular Construction’, and ‘Biomolecules’ are essential for NEET aspirants.

In whole, the NEET 2025 syllabus contains sixty nine chapters: twenty in Biology, 19 in Physics, and 30 in Chemistry.
